The legendary Queen concert at Hammersmith, London in 1979 is known as one of the most famous live performances along with Live Aid. The concert was broadcast on TV as part of the Cambodia relief charity concert, and it is well known as a must-see pro-shot live video for fans. This is the first release from MASTERWORKS! The CD contains a stereo remix of the original soundboard and video footage, and a stereo remix of the original soundboard and video footage. The DVD contains a newly edited version of the original video, which has been re-edited based on multiple video sources. The DVD includes the original edited version, which was re-edited based on multiple video sources, and also coupled with a pro-shot of the Budokan concert broadcast on TV from the band's third Japan tour in 1979. Also included are additional unaired cut footage and rare TV reports and interviews from that time. Like the now legendary Live Aid, this is the latest title of the special collector's edition of Queen's last great performance in the 70's, which evoked miracles at the special concert!

The longest version of the stereo remix soundboard is now available on CD for the first time!
First DVD of the new original edited version re-edited from multiple video sources!
Remastered video of the Budokan concert that was broadcast on TV in 1979 is also included.
Includes unaired cut footage and rare TV reports and interviews from that time.

[SELLING POINT]

The CD contains a stereo remix of the original monaural soundboard source of the leaked pro shot video, mixed with an audience recording for a more realistic experience. This method was previously used for the video, but this time, it has been upgraded to more closely resemble the original master. Also, the uncut version of “Crazy Little Thing Called Love,” the ending of which was shortened in the video, is included on the soundboard, which is longer than the video where the band starts playing again in response to the audience refrain. The DVD is a newly re-edited original version based on several existing TV broadcasts and pro-shot footage. The DVD is a new master version of the original DVD, which has been re-edited based on the existing TV broadcasts and pro-shot footage. The TV broadcast footage of the Budokan concert in 1979 has also been remastered in high sound and image quality, and in addition to the full-length TV broadcast, unaired cut footage, rare TV news reports and rare TV interviews have also been added with improved image quality.
